    Dr. Chao office is very nice and tidy. It's located in the allied physician building with a lab and…read moreurgent care. They are located in suite B inside. Excellent location as they are near the gold line and have plenty of parking in the back. The security guard at the front was nice and helpful letting us know what time the office is opened and that we could wait in the lobby until they opened. The staff is very nice and helpful to their patients. Very easy to talk to them. The plus was they were able to speak Chinese (Mandarin)to my dad. The technician was efficient and checked his vision, eye pressure (with a tono pen), checking pupils, extra ocular motility (EOM) and getting a complete chief complaint and asked if reading was an issue (which is was not). The one thing I would have checked is confrontational fields, but other than that she did an excellent job. She then proceeded to dilate his pupils and explained to him about the process and the expect his near vision to be blurry due to dilation and to wear sun glasses when outside (due to increased incoming light from pupils being dilated). She performed imaging to check the macula and retina and optic nerve. We then saw Dr. Chao who is a fantastic physician performed a thorough exam and explained to my father about cataract surgery in Chinese, explained what she saw and how bad his cataracts were and asked him specific questions about his vision and discussed the different lens options available and which my father would like to receive. (Standard lens usually set for distance and would require glasses for reading or one can opt for a multifocal lens where you don't need to wear glasses but this type of lens is not covered by insurance and would be out of pocket). Dr. Chao is an ophthalmologist who specializes in Glaucoma (treats patients with high eye pressure which can lead to blindness if left untreated) and is also a cataract surgeon and comprehensive ophthalmologist (sees patients for any eye issues and can refer out to specialists as needed). Then we scheduled a surgery date and will need to see his primary care physician (PCP) for clearance will need to return for a follow up appointment to get his biometry measurements for the lens prior to surgery. My dad was happy with his first visit and looks forward to his follow up visit.
